CommunicAsia2015: ScheduALL Presents End-to-End Resource Provisioning

ScheduALL, a global provider of Enterprise Resource Management (ERM) solutions for media, broadcast and transmission businesses since 1989, will showcase their award-winning self-provisioning scheduling solution, ScheduALL Portal at CommunicAsia2015 in Singapore. In addition, ScheduALL will demonstrate their end-to-end provisioning tools, ScheduALL Connector and ScheduALL Chorus.
Portal simplifies the complex process of booking Occasional Use transmission feeds. Utilizing a browser-based, user-friendly wizard for selling transmission feeds, Portal allows users to quickly make transmission bookings in real-time, directly into a transmission provider’s system-all without requiring in-depth network expertise. Meanwhile, behind the scenes Portal leverages all of the  power and complexity of ScheduALL’s resource scheduling and conflict resolution. In addition to the industry acclaim received since coming to market, Portal was just awarded TV Technology’s prestigious Best of Show Award at the recent 2015 NAB Show.

Like Portal, Connector is a powerful self-provisioning platform, and brings together ScheduALL’s large global population of users across more than 50 countries using ScheduALL to manage their resource inventory. Connector provides a direct link between resource providers and their customers, uniting ScheduALL systems across global business partners.

Chorus is ScheduALL’s interoperability platform, which leverages advanced technology for an enterprise’s disparate business systems to fluidly and effectively communicate. From ingest to playout, Chorus exchanges the information needed to streamline and advance projects, workflows, reporting and other key capabilities.

These self-provisioning and interoperability solutions eliminate tedious emails, phone calls and spreadsheets, and automate time consuming manual processes, while providing visibility and intelligent control to streamline the entire end-to-end process from booking to distribution. Transmission providers and their customers have a centralized view of a global resource network, increasing revenue through maximized utilization.
